A woman who was eight months pregnant when she was kidnapped from a Rio de Janeiro slum was found murdered next to a train track - but her baby was missing, a medical examiner's report has revealed.

Thaysa Campos, 23, vanished on September 3 last year after leaving her home to pick up a maternity bag at a friend's home.

Her body was found dumped on a train track in the Rio de Janeiro neighborhood of Deodoro on September 10.

But an autopsy report this week revealed that there was no trace of her baby, and no cuts were found on her belly, leading to fears she may have been forced into labor before she died, Brazilian news portal Extra reports.
